The Mechanics of Forex Trading
At its core, forex trading involves trading currency pairs, such as EUR/USD or GBP/JPY. Each pair consists of a base currency and a quote currency, where the value of the base currency is quoted relative to the quote currency. Traders can go long (buy) or short (sell) based on their expectations of currency movements. Understanding how these pairs work is essential for anyone looking to succeed in this market.
Market Updates and Trends
Staying updated on market trends and news is crucial for effective trading in forex. Economic indicators, geopolitical events, and shifts in market sentiment can all influence currency values. Many traders rely on various tools and resources, including charts and economic calendars, to make informed decisions. By keeping abreast of market updates, traders can enhance their strategies and potentially increase their chances of profit.
